Why Your RBC Blood Test Results Are The Ultimate Indicator Of Cellular Health And Fatigue
If you are struggling with unexplained fatigue, persistent dizziness, or shortness of breath, your physician will likely order a complete blood count (CBC), which includes an rbc blood test. Red blood cells (RBCs) are the cellular workhorses of the cardiovascular system, tasked with transporting vital oxygen from your lungs to every tissue in your body. Understanding your RBC count is not just routine medical admin; it is a critical diagnostic gateway to identifying anemia, dehydration, and underlying chronic conditions.
| Patient Demographic | Normal RBC Range (Million cells/mcL) | Key Diagnostic Implications |
|---|---|---|
| Adult Males | 4.7 to 6.1 | High indicates dehydration/hypoxia; Low indicates anemia. |
| Adult Females | 4.2 to 5.4 | Heavily influenced by menstrual cycles and iron stores. |
| Children | 4.0 to 5.5 | Ranges vary slightly based on specific pediatric age brackets. |
| Pregnant Patients | Slightly lower than 4.2 | Blood volume expands during pregnancy, diluting cell concentration. |
The Oxygen Highway: What High or Low RBC Counts Reveal About Your Body
When your rbc blood test results fall outside the standard reference intervals, it indicates an imbalance in your body's oxygen-carrying capacity. A low RBC count, clinically known as erythropenia, means your tissues are not receiving sufficient oxygen. This depletion is most commonly triggered by iron, vitamin B12, or folate deficiencies, internal bleeding, or chronic kidney disease, where the kidneys fail to produce enough erythropoietin (the hormone that stimulates RBC production).
Conversely, an elevated RBC count, known as erythrocytosis, presents its own set of clinical challenges. When the concentration of red blood cells is too high, your blood thickens, increasing the risk of blood clots, strokes, and heart attacks. High counts are frequently caused by chronic dehydration, smoking, sleep apnea, or living at high altitudes where oxygen levels are naturally lower. In rare cases, it can point to polycythemia vera, a bone marrow disorder that requires immediate hematological management.
Preparing for Your Draw: How to Get Accurate RBC Blood Test Results
Acquiring an accurate rbc blood test requires minimal preparation, but paying attention to small details can prevent skewed results. While a standalone RBC or CBC test does not typically require fasting, patients are strongly advised to consult their healthcare provider, as blood draws are often bundled with comprehensive metabolic panels that do require fasting.
- Hydrate Well: Dehydration artificially concentrates your blood, which can falsely elevate your RBC count on paper. Drink plenty of water in the 24 hours leading up to your blood draw.
- Disclose Medications: Certain prescription drugs, including gentamycin, methyldopa, and hormonal therapies, can alter your red blood cell production.
- Avoid Strenuous Exercise: Intense, exhausting physical activity right before your test can temporarily alter fluid balance and cellular concentration in your bloodstream.

Next-Generation Diagnostics: The Evolution of Hematology in 2026
The landscape of hematology is shifting rapidly, with modern laboratories utilizing advanced flow cytometry and artificial intelligence to analyze red blood cells far beyond simple numerical counts. In 2026, pathologists are utilizing machine learning algorithms to evaluate subtle changes in RBC size (MCV) and shape variation (RDW) to predict hematologic trends before patients even exhibit physical symptoms of fatigue or nutrient malabsorption.
Furthermore, point-of-care microfluidic testing is gaining traction in remote clinics. These localized testing devices require only a single finger-prick of blood to deliver a complete rbc blood test analysis in under five minutes, eliminating the wait times associated with centralized hospital laboratories.
